Scratch awls predate the modern workshop by centuries — the same tapered steel point was standard equipment for anyone doing precision layout work in wood, metal, or leather long before a machinist’s scribe or a marking knife existed as separate specialized tools. What’s kept it in toolboxes this long isn’t tradition, it’s that a pencil line has real width and can wander slightly as graphite wears down, while a scored line from a hardened point is a fraction of a millimeter wide and stays exactly where you put it — the difference matters most right at the moment a saw blade or drill bit needs to track a line exactly.

Primary Uses
The two jobs a scratch awl does better than almost any other hand tool are scribing a cut line and starting a pilot mark. For scribing, dragging the point along a straightedge severs the surface wood fibers cleanly before a saw ever touches the board — that pre-scored line is what keeps a crosscut from tearing out a ragged edge on the show face, especially in figured or cross-grain wood where a saw blade alone would lift fibers ahead of the cut.
For starting screws, pressing the point in to create a small dimple gives a drill bit or screw tip something to register into instead of skating sideways across smooth wood grain when it first makes contact — that initial wander is exactly what causes an off-center pilot hole or a screw that drives in crooked. In softer woods like pine, where a spinning bit can walk several millimeters before it bites, that dimple is often the difference between a screw landing where you marked it and one landing noticeably off.
Woodworking Applications
Beyond the basic scribe-and-dimple uses above, a scratch awl is the standard tool for transferring a layout from a template or story stick onto actual stock — pressing through a paper or thin plywood template at each marked point leaves an exact, unambiguous dot on the wood underneath, which is more reliable than trying to trace a pencil around a template’s edge.
It’s also useful for checking grain direction on an unfamiliar board: dragging the point lightly across the surface at a shallow angle catches and lifts slightly against the grain, while it glides smoothly with the grain — a quick, low-tech way to confirm which direction to plane or sand before committing to a pass.
Metalworking Applications
On metal, a scratch awl functions essentially the same way a machinist’s scribe does — the hardened point is typically harder than mild steel or aluminum sheet, so it cuts a fine, permanent line into the surface rather than just marking on top of it the way a marker or grease pencil would. That permanence matters for layout lines that need to survive handling, cutting fluid, and the vibration of a saw or grinder without wearing off partway through the job.
The same pilot-dimple technique from woodworking carries over to metal drilling, where it’s arguably even more important: a drill bit meeting bare, smooth sheet metal at an angle will “walk” noticeably before it starts cutting, and a center-punched or awl-marked dimple is what keeps the hole where you intended it. A shop working across both wood and metal gets double duty out of one tool for this reason.
Leatherworking Uses
Leatherworkers reach for a scratch awl (often called a stitching awl in this context) as often as woodworkers do, but for a slightly different reason: leather doesn’t hold a pencil line well and readily shows scoring, so a scratch awl traces a pattern edge or fold line directly onto the hide with a mark that stays visible through the cutting and folding process without smudging the way chalk or pencil would.
For hand-stitched work, the awl’s real job is punching the stitching holes themselves — pushed through at a consistent angle and spacing, it opens a clean channel for two needles to pass through from opposite sides, which is how traditional saddle-stitching is done. A diamond-shaped or wide-blade awl point (rather than a round one) is generally preferred for stitching specifically because it leaves a slit the thread can lock into rather than a round hole the stitches can slip around in.
Diy And Craft Projects
Around the house, a scratch awl earns its keep on small repairs a full toolkit feels like overkill for: marking a screw location on drywall before it goes in, popping a stuck picture-hanger nail loose, or starting a pilot dimple in a piece of trim too thin to safely drill without one. It’s also handy for backing a small nail out partway by working the point under the head as a makeshift pry point when a hammer’s claw can’t get underneath it.
In crafts, the same fine point that scores wood works just as well on card stock, polymer clay, and thin plastic — piercing a clean starting hole for eyelets or brads, scoring a fold line in card stock for a crisper crease than hand-folding alone gives, or adding fine detail lines into clay before it cures.
Choosing The Right Scratch Awl
Handle material mostly comes down to grip and feedback rather than raw durability, since the point (nearly always hardened steel regardless of handle) is what actually does the work. A turned hardwood handle gives the most tactile control for fine scribing work and is the traditional choice; molded plastic handles are cheaper and more common in general hardware-store awls but can feel slippery under real hand pressure during extended use.
Point shape should match the job more than personal preference: a round, tapered point is the general-purpose default for wood and metal marking, while a diamond or four-sided point is specifically better for leather stitching, since its edges cut a small slit rather than just displacing fibers the way a round point does. Overall length matters too — a shorter awl gives more control for fine detail work, while a longer one gives more leverage for pushing through thicker material like heavy leather or dense hardwood.

Maintenance Tips
Regular cleaning and periodic sharpening are what keep an awl performing like new instead of gradually getting harder to use without you noticing why.
Cleaning And Storage
Wipe the point down after use, especially after leatherworking where oils and dyes in the hide can transfer onto the steel and slowly corrode it if left. A dry, enclosed spot — a toolbox slot or a sheathed storage block — keeps ambient moisture off the point between uses, which matters more than it might seem since a fine point rusts and pits faster than a broader steel surface would.
Sharpening Techniques
An awl that’s gone dull won’t score a clean line anymore — instead of cutting fibers cleanly it starts to tear or skip, which is the sign it needs attention. Draw the tip across a fine-grit sharpening stone at a consistent angle, rotating it slightly with each pass to maintain the point’s natural taper rather than grinding a flat facet on one side, and check progress by touch every few passes rather than sharpening blind. A light touch matters here: over-aggressive pressure removes material faster than needed and can throw the point out of round.
Safety Precautions
A scratch awl’s entire function depends on a sharp, exposed point, which means the same qualities that make it useful also make it genuinely easy to stab yourself with if you’re careless — more so than a knife, since there’s no visible cutting edge warning your hand away from it the way a blade does. Keep your off-hand entirely behind the direction of travel when scribing or piercing, never in front of or alongside the point, so a slip drives the tip into the workbench instead of your palm.
When it’s not in your hand, an awl belongs point-down in a dedicated holder or sheathed, not loose in a pocket, a drawer you reach into blind, or rattling around in a tool bag where it can find a hand by accident. Safety glasses are worth wearing specifically when starting pilot holes in harder materials, where the point can occasionally skip sideways off the surface before it bites in.

Frequently Asked Questions
What Is A Scratch Awl Used For?
A scratch awl is used for marking and scribing lines on wood, metal, or plastic. It helps create precise measurements and guides for cuts.
How Do You Use A Scratch Awl?
To use a scratch awl, hold it firmly and drag the pointed tip along the material. This creates a visible scribe line for guidance.
Can A Scratch Awl Be Used On Metal?
Yes, a scratch awl can be used on metal. Its pointed tip makes precise lines on metal surfaces for cutting or drilling.
What Materials Can A Scratch Awl Mark?
A scratch awl can mark wood, metal, plastic, and leather. It is versatile for various projects needing precise scribe lines.
